body, div, form, p, ul, ol, li, h1, h2, h3, h4, h5, h6 { margin:0px; padding: 0px;}
html{margin:0px; padding:0px;}
ul, ol, dl, li {list-style-type:none;}

body{font-family:"Trebuchet MS", Arial, Helvetica, sans-serif; font-size:13px; color:#767677; background:#eaeaea}
#wraper{width:980px; background:#FFFFFF; margin:0 auto;}

#header1{width:100%;border-top:#61707f 20px solid;} 
#header {height:200px; width:980px; background:#FFFFFF; margin:0px auto}
#logo{float:left; margin:30px 7px 0px 75px; width:340px; height:90px;}
#phone-container{width:200px; height:32px; float:left; margin:60px 0 0px 10px; background:url(../images/phone.png) no-repeat; padding-left:45px; color:#4098db; font-family:Arial, Helvetica, sans-serif; font-size:12px}
.phone_text{font-size:12px; color:#4098db; float:left; line-height:18px;}
#sitemp{ float:left; height:19px; height:80px; margin:82px 0 0 190px; background:url(../images/sitemap_icon.png) no-repeat  top right; padding-right:20px; padding-top:10px}


#banner-container{width:980px; float:left;}
#banner-inner{width:676px; float:left;}
#banner-info{width:285px; height:274px; float:left; margin-left:12px; background:#f4f6fc;}
#scroll-container{width:680px; float:left; margin:0px 20px 0px 0px; background:#FFFFFF;}
#bhutan_map{width:200px; height:200px; float:left; padding-top:50px;}
#side_img{width:260px; height:240px; float:left;margin-top:0px; background:#dfe2e5}
#right_container_main{width:270px; float:left;}


#welcome-container{width:980px; height:160px; float:left; background:#e2e1e1; border-bottom:1px solid #b0b0b0;  border-top:1px solid #b0b0b0;} 
.welcome-hd{ font-size:20px; color:#3b5998; text-align:center; margin:10px 0;}
.welcome-text{ font-size:12px; color:#4a4a4a; text-align:center; width:800px; margin:10px auto;}

#package-container{height:300px; width:306px; float:left; margin:0px 10px 40px 7px; background:#ffffff; border:#cecece 1px solid;}
#package-img{height:200px; width:306px; float:left; margin:0px 0 0 0px;}
.package-heading{ font-size:30px; color:#3d454b; text-align:center; margin:2px 0; font-family: "Arabic Typesetting";}
.package-text{ font-size:11px; color:#4a4a4a; width:270px; margin:0px auto; text-align:center;}
#readmore-button{height:24px; width:102px; float:left; margin-top:8px; margin-left:100px}

#left-container{ width:665px; float:left; margin:0 0 10px 10px;}
#tour_heading{ font-size:16px; color:#ffffff; font-weight:bold; background:#005b81; text-transform:uppercase; float:left; width:655px; padding:5px 5px 5px 5px; margin:10px 0 12px 0;}
.image{ width:183px; height:144px; float:left; margin:0px 10px 10px 5px; border:2px solid #ffffff;}
#tour_box{ background:#ECECEE; padding: 10px 0 0 0; width:665px; float:left;}


.banner-info-_hd{ color:#696969; font-size:16px; text-align:center; margin-bottom:10px; text-transform:uppercase;}
.destination-hd{ font-size:24px; color:#4098db; text-align:center; width:980px; text-transform:uppercase; margin:20px 0; background:#eaeaea; font-family:Elephant;}
h1 {color:#8fbf4d; font-size:30px; font-weight:normal; margin-bottom:10px;}
h2 {color:#005b81; font-size:18px; font-weight:normal; margin:10px 0;}
h3 {font-size:14px; margin-bottom:10px;}
p {line-height:18px; margin:0; padding-bottom:10px; font-size:13px; text-align:justify;}

#readmore a{font-size:11px; font-family:Arial, Helvetica, sans-serif; color:#de272e; text-decoration:none; margin:15px auto; text-transform:uppercase; background:url(../images/round_arrow.png) no-repeat bottom; height:50px; width:67px; display:block;}
#readmore a:hover{color:#5b7ec7;}

#booknow {height:27px; width:94px; float:right; margin:10px 10px 0 0;}
#booknow a{height:27px; width:94px; border:0; }

#view-itinirary {height:27px; width:126px; float:right; margin:10px 10px 0 0px;}
#view-itinirary a{height:27px; width:126px; border:0; }
#back {height:27px; width:64px; float:right; margin:10px 10px 0 0;}
#back a{height:27px; width:69px; border:0; }

<!--Main Nav -->
.clearboth{margin:0; padding:0; clear:both;}
#nav{font-family:Arial, Helvetica, sans-serif; font-size:12px; text-transform:uppercase; float:left; width:980px; background:#fcd90b; margin-top:-20px;}
#nav ul{margin:0; padding:0; list-style:none; }
#nav a {display:block; padding:12px 22px 12px 21px; color:#000000; text-decoration:none; border-right:0px solid #fde660;}
<!--#nav a:hover{color:#fcd90b}-->
#nav li {float:left; background:#fcd90b; position:relative; z-index:2000;}
#nav li li{width:140px; font-size:10px; height:35px; border-bottom:solid 1px #fde660; padding:3px; border-right:none;}
#nav li:hover {background:#666666;}
#nav li a.active {background:#666666;}
#nav li li:hover {background:#666666;}	
#nav ul ul {position:absolute; visibility:hidden;  z-index:2000;border-right:none}
#nav ul ul ul{position:absolute; left:100%;	top:-1px; z-index:2000; border-right:none}  
#nav li:hover > ul {visibility:visible;}
<!--Main Nav -->

#right-container{ width:285px; float:left; margin-left:12px; background:#f4f6fc;}
<!--Right Menu-->
.rightmenu{width:360px; float:left; margin-top:20px;}
.rightmenu .headerbar{font-family:Arial, Helvetica, sans-serif; font-size:16px; text-transform:uppercase; color:#ffffff; padding:6px 0 6px 5px; background:#fcd90b;}
.rightmenu ul{list-style-type:none; margin:0;}
.rightmenu ul li{padding-bottom:0px;}
.rightmenu ul li a{color:#a0a0a1; background:#ffffff url(../images/arrow.png) no-repeat center left ; display:block; padding:8px 0; padding-left:25px; text-decoration:none; font-size:13px; border-bottom:1px #d3d3d4 dashed;}
.rightmenu ul li a:hover{color:#ff8702;}
.rightmenu ul li a.active{color:#ff8702;}
<!--Right Menu-->

<!--Arrow list Menu-->
.arrowlistmenu{ width:auto; float:left; width:200px;}
.arrowlistmenu .headerbar{ font-size:16px; text-align:left; color:#ffffff; padding-bottom:5px; text-transform:uppercase;}
.arrowlistmenu ul{list-style-type:none; margin-bottom:20px;}
.arrowlistmenu ul li{padding-bottom:2px;}
.arrowlistmenu ul li a{color:#ffffff; display:block; padding:1px 0; text-transform:uppercase; text-decoration:none; font-size:13px;}
.arrowlistmenu ul li a:hover{color:#f9b92d;}
.arrowlistmenu ul li a.active{color:#f9b92d;}
<!--Arrow list Menu-->

#contact-form{width:225px; float:left; color:#ffffff;}
#testimonial{width:180px; height:180px; float:left; background:#f1f1f1; padding:10px 5px; margin:0 40px;}
.testimonial-hd{ font-size:18px; color:#b5423f; text-align:center; width:180px; margin-bottom:10px;}
.testimonial-text{ font-size:12px; color:#4a4a4a; text-align:center; width:180px; line-height:16px;}

#fb{width:283px; height:174px; float:left;}

#footer{}
#footer-container{ height:150px; width:100%; background:#61707f;}
#footer-inner{ height:120px; width:980px; margin:0 auto; padding-top:15px;}




#copyright-container{ height:30px; width:100%; background:#3e4246;}
#copyright-inner{ height:30px; width:980px; margin:0 auto;}
#copyright{ font-size:12px; color:#ffffff; float:left; line-height:30px; width:980px;}
#copyright a{color:#ffffff; text-decoration:none;}
#copyright a:hover{ color:#adaba8; text-decoration:underline;}

#social{ height:40px; width:100px; float:left; margin-top:20px; margin-left:20px; font-size:14px; font-family:Arial, Helvetica, sans-serif; color:#FFFFFF}
.social-icon{height:34px; width:34px; float:left; margin-left:7px;}

#logo11{float:left; margin:10px 7px 0px 95px; width:407px; height:117px;}

.input{height:25px; margin:3px 0; color:#666363;}

ul.bjqs{position:relative; list-style:none;padding:0;margin:0;overflow:hidden; display:none;}
li.bjqs-slide{position:absolute; display:none;}

#submit_btn{width:87px; height:25px; background:#3d454b; color:#FFFFFF; border:none; margin-left:90px;}
#submit_btn:hover { cursor:pointer; color:#4098db;}

#submit_btn1{width:87px; height:25px; background:#4098db; color:#FFFFFF; border:none; margin-left:90px;}
#submit_btn1:hover { cursor:pointer; color:#000000;}



#tour_heading{ font-size:16px; color:#000000; font-weight:bold; background:#fcd90b; text-transform:uppercase; float:left; width:680px; padding:5px 5px 5px 5px; margin:10px 0 12px 0;}
#calendar1{  float:right; background:url(../images/calender.png) no-repeat top left; padding-left:35px; font-size:14px; height:27px}
#tour_itinerary{background:#FFFFFF; padding:5px; width:680px; float:left;}
#tour_para1{font-size:13px; font-weight:normal; color:#525252; text-align:justify; line-height:18px; width:680px; float:left; padding-bottom:10px; margin-bottom:5px; border-bottom:1px dashed #CCCCCC;}
#tour_hd{ font-size:16px; font-weight:bold; color:#ffa609; float:left; margin:0px 0 10px 0; width:355px;}
#booknow {height:85px; width:150px; float:right; margin:10px 10px 0 0;}
#booknow a{height:85px; width:150px; border:0; }
#back {height:27px; width:64px; float:right; margin:10px 10px 0 0;}
#back a{height:27px; width:69px; border:0; }

#tp-box2{width:220px; float:left; margin:0px 3px 0 0;}
#tour-thumb{margin:0px 0 15px 0; border:1px #f4f4f4 solid; width:216px; height:120px;}
h7{font-size:17px;color:#990000; line-height:30px;}

.image2{width:100px; height:80px; float:left; margin:0 10px 0 0px; border:2px #ffffff solid;}
#accoparahd_text{text-align:left; font-weight:normal; color:#777777; font-size:14px; margin:5px 0 10px 0;}
#tp-box1{width:660px; float:left; padding:0 0 10px 0; border-bottom:1px #343434 dotted;}

#address-box{width:400px; float:left;margin:0px 0 0 40px;}
#adrs{font-size:16px;line-height:30px;color:#000000;text-align:justify;}